abet to incite, encourage, or aid, especially in wrongdoing.
deleterious harmful or injurious, as to health.
disseminate to spread widely, as though scattering seed.
entrench to establish firmly and unchangeably.
exemplar one worthy to be imitated or studied; model.
expatriate one who has gone into exile from or renounced allegiance to his or her native land.
gender the sex of a person or animal.
imbibe to take up or consume by drinking.
importune to pester with insistent demands or requests.
invoke to call out to (a god, muse, or the like) for help, support, protection, or inspiration.
lackluster without brilliance or vitality; dull.
mortify to subject (someone) to extreme embarrassment, shame, or humiliation.
peccadillo a minor sin or offense, or a slight fault.
remonstrance the act or an instance of protesting or objecting.
traverse to go over, along, or through; cover or cross.
